Elire is a Minneapolis-based software consulting firm focusing on helping organizations maximize their software investments. It specializes in implementing, upgrading, and integrating Oracle Cloud ERP, HCM, and SCM, as well as PeopleSoft upgrades and implementations, and also offers Treasury Management System deployment. The company delivers services from planning through deployment, including data migration, testing, change management, and post-implementation support, supported by Oracle partnerships. By merging several successful firms, it combines technical delivery with strategic guidance on business-process improvement to help clients achieve successful software outcomes.

DEMO | Elire BankBridge™: Complex Solutions Made Easy — Elire Consulting

The Elire BankBridge TM is a cloud-based connectivity hub providing a secure, single pipeline for straight-through processing of bank and other financial counterparty information.
